GdS: A heartfelt choice – why Yacine Adli has taken the No.94 shirt

By Oliver Fisher -

When the news emerged yesterday that Alvaro Morata had been granted his favoured squad number, it also became clear that Yacine Adli had changed to quite a strange one.

As La Gazzetta dello Sport recall, Morata thanked Adli on social media yesterday for vacating the No.7 shirt so he could take it: “We don’t know each other yet, but you did a beautiful thing for me. Thank you, see you soon.”

Adli’s response then came: “I hope you score lots of goals with this shirt. Forza Milan, see you soon”. It was a heart-warming back-and-forth with lots of red and black emojis involved, and the former Bordeaux midfielder made it known that he opted for No.94.

The reason for that is to be found in his origins. Adli is very attached to Villejuif, the town on the outskirts of Paris where he grew up and was educated, and 94 is the number that identifies the department of Val de Marne.

Every year, among other things, the association founded by Adli organizes a charity tournament for the kids of the town and they all take to the field with the number 94 on their backs. In short, it is a heartfelt choice for him.
